Goal

To test the effect of the following house rules under the latest Beta 1.05.63.

House Rules

Axis AI Morale 110
Soviet Human Morale 100
Forts at 25 for both sides
All else left at 100

Modelling of Soviet Shock, as suggested by delatbabel here tm.asp?m=3038859

My version of his suggested house rule:

Turn 1. Do nothing = Soviet shock
Turn 2. Move Sov air units and counter attack with Sov armour or mech only
Turn 3. Move Sov reserve units only (that is, units at least 10 hexes away from any Axis unit).
Turn 4. Move out of contact Sov units only (>2 hexes away from any Axis unit).
Turn 5 onwards, normal movement and combat.

TURN 4

AGN and AGC push forward 3-4 hexes each.

Riga still stands

A bit of activity by AGS this turn, but under my house rules I would be able to escape the burgeoning Lvov pocket if I continued the game.

But I'm not going to. I don't find this to be a particularly impressive outcome for the AI, given that it's only T4 and I haven't put up any resistance to speak of.

Things needing attention:

1. AI still not attacking cities.
2. AI acting too cautiously during the Barbarossa phase - should be going hell for leather to the East at this stage.
